Omega Releases OM-SQ2020 Portable Data Logger

Omega’s OM-SQ2020 series of handheld data loggers have eight true differential or 16 single-ended universal analog inputs plus two high voltage, four pulse and eight digital event/state inputs.

The analog inputs can be used with thermistors,  thermocouples, two-, three-, or four-wire RTD temperature sensors, voltage, and 4 to 20 mA signals.

The simple 4 push button user interface and LCD makes this CE-compliant product easy to operate. This product includes Windows software for data logger setup and data transfer to PC. It is suited to industrial,  scientific research, and quality assurance applications.

Prices start at $2,395.
